Know The Room: Dating Jewish Singles With Respect

Start with curiosity, not assumptions. If you’re browsing profiles of Jewish singles on Mingle2, remember the label can mean many things: religious practice, cultural background, family traditions, or simply a part of someone’s identity. Use that as context to guide thoughtful questions rather than a checklist that defines the whole person.

Set clear intent and expectations. Decide what matters to you—whether it’s shared values, cultural connection, or simply enjoying similar traditions—and communicate that honestly. Being upfront about whether you’re exploring, dating casually, or looking for something long-term helps avoid misunderstandings.

Avoid assumptions and stereotypes. Don’t presume religious observance, political views, or family expectations based on someone’s background. Ask about what matters to them personally: upbringing, how they observe holidays (if at all), and how culture fits into their life now.

Ask respectful, open questions. Frame questions so they invite conversation: “Do family traditions matter to you?” or “What does your cultural background mean to you?” rather than yes/no prompts. Listen to the answer and follow up on specifics they choose to share.

Respect boundaries and privacy. Some topics—religious practice, family dynamics, or personal history—may be sensitive. If someone seems hesitant, give space and let them lead when they want to dig deeper.

Show genuine interest without exoticizing. Appreciate traditions and holidays they mention, but treat them as part of a whole person’s life. Compliments and questions should feel sincere and grounded, not like you’re treating culture as a novelty.

Be adaptable and communicate about compatibility. If cultural or religious differences come up, talk openly about practicalities—holiday plans, dietary preferences, family expectations—and whether compromises feel comfortable for both of you.

Approach every conversation with kindness and curiosity. That combination keeps interactions respectful and helps you learn whether you click beyond the category label.

Dating Confidence Reset: Practical Steps To Stay Grounded

Start by clarifying what you want before you swipe or message. Decide whether you’re looking for casual conversation, friendship, dating, or something long-term, and set a time-limited goal for each chat so you don’t burn energy on unclear outcomes.

Pace conversations on purpose. Open with a light question, follow with one meaningful detail, and give yourself permission to pause before replying. A steady pace shows confidence and helps you spot people who match your rhythm instead of chasing every fast‑moving chat.

Keep expectations realistic. Treat first messages and early chats as sampling, not commitments. Expect some dead-ends and polite declines—they are part of the process, not a reflection of your worth. When a conversation doesn’t lead anywhere, mentally file it as data and move on.

Notice small progress. Track wins that aren’t just replies: clearer answers about intent, getting a date offer, or learning more about someone’s values. Celebrating these small signals shifts your focus from quantity to quality.

Choose matches more thoughtfully. Scan profiles for concrete cues—shared interests, lifestyle hints, and things you genuinely care about—rather than reacting to photos or vague bios. When you match, ask a question that reveals a value (for example: “What’s a small thing that makes your week better?”) to test compatibility early.

Manage emotional energy and boundaries. Limit daily time spent swiping or answering messages, and use short rules like “one new conversation at a time” or “no texting after midnight” to protect your patience. If a message makes you uncomfortable, step back, set a boundary, or end the chat—politeness is fine, but obligation isn’t.
